Topic: Triton FEThead v/s Rode D-PowerPlug?
Replies: 3
Views: 3731

The power plug is extremely noisy, unusably so. I tried to use one with a Shure SM7, more or less an ideal candidate for adding gain to a dynamic mic. Horridly noisy, even on relatively loud sources (aka, exactly what you wouldn't need the extra gain for). So yeah, don't waste your dough. Let us kno...
